About This Fund
AAIC Africa Innovation & Healthcare Fund (AHF No. 2) is the second venture and impact fund managed by AAIC Investment, a Japan-based specialist investor dedicated to the African startup ecosystem. The fund made its first close at the end of March 2022 and completed its second close in October 2023. Together with the predecessor AAIC Africa Healthcare Fund (AHF-1), the two funds represent a combined investment pool of approximately $87 million (approximately 13 billion yen), establishing AAIC Investment as one of the largest Japan-based Africa-dedicated venture capital platforms.
Building on the healthcare-focused mandate of AHF-1, the second fund broadens its sectoral scope to include innovation-driven companies in adjacent verticals including HR technology, mobility and transportation, retail technology, and consumer internet businesses, alongside the core healthcare investment thesis. The fund targets venture and growth-stage investments across pan-African technology hubs, with concentrated portfolio exposure in Kenya, Nigeria, Rwanda, Uganda, South Africa, Egypt, Tanzania, Ethiopia, and Ghana. AAIC's investment model leverages Japanese corporate networks — including pharmaceutical companies, technology conglomerates, and trading houses — to create strategic value for portfolio companies seeking expansion into Japanese and broader Asian markets, providing a differentiated value-add beyond capital alone.
The fund has attracted Japanese institutional and corporate investors including Marubeni Corporation, one of Japan's largest general trading companies, demonstrating the strategic appeal of the Africa-Japan technology corridor that AAIC Investment facilitates. Portfolio companies across the combined AAIC fund family have achieved notable international recognition, with five companies selected as Time magazine's 100 World's Top HealthTech Companies of 2025 — a benchmark that validates AAIC's ability to identify transformative African health and technology businesses at early stages. The fund's expanded sectoral scope reflects AAIC Investment's thesis that Africa's technology innovation extends well beyond healthcare into adjacent domains reshaping daily life across the continent.
